CentOS6下安装部署MySQL5.7服务器
MySQL是一种开放源码的关系型数据库管理系统,被广泛地应用于Web应用软件开发中。在CentOS6操作系统下搭建MySQL5.7服务器是非常简单的,本文将介绍如何安装部署MySQL5.7服务器,并提供相关代码。
1. 前置条件
在安装部署MySQL5.7服务器之前,需要确保以下条件已经满足:
– 在CentOS6操作系统下安装了wget和tar命令
– 具备sudo权限的用户账户
– 拥有可写的目录用于下载和安装MySQL5.7
2. 下载MySQL5.7
为了使这一步骤更加简单快捷,我们将使用wget命令从MySQL官方网站下载MySQL5.7。
$ sudo wget https://dev.mysql.com/get/mysql57-community-release-el6-11.noarch.rpm
3. 安装MySQL5.7
下载后的MySQL5.7在.rpm文件中,我们需要使用yum命令进行安装,具体命令如下:
$ sudo rpm -ivh mysql57-community-release-el6-11.noarch.rpm
$ sudo yum update
$ sudo yum install mysql-server
这些命令将会安装MySQL数据库服务器和客户端。
4. 启动MySQL5.7
安装完成后,我们需要启动MySQL5.7服务,具体命令如下:
$ sudo service mysqld start
5. 修改MySQL5.7的root账户密码
MySQL服务器默认root账户是没有密码的,需要进行修改并设置新密码。具体步骤如下:
– 登录MySQL服务器
$ sudo mysql -u root
– 设置新密码
m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
6. 测试MySQL5.7
安装完成后,我们需要进行一些简单的测试以确保MySQL5.7服务器已经正确安装部署。具体命令如下:
– 登录MySQL服务器
$ sudo mysql -u root -p
– 输入密码后进入MySQL命令行,创建一个简单的测试数据表,例如:
mysql> CREATE DATABASE testdb;
mysql> USE testdb;
mysql> CREATE TABLE users (id INT, name VARCHAR(255));
– 确认数据表已经被创建,例如:
mysql> SHOW TABLES;
+------------------+
| Tables_in_testdb |
+------------------+
| users |
+------------------+
至此,我们已经成功安装部署了MySQL5.7服务器,并且创建了一个简单的数据表。有了这个基础,我们就可以进一步开始使用和开发MySQL数据库了。
尽管MySQL安装部署的过程并不复杂,但在操作中仍然有可能出现一些问题。在实践中,需要一定的经验和技巧才能更快地处理这些问题。如果您遇到了任何MySQL5.7安装和使用的问题,可以参考MySQL官方文档或者寻求专业的技术支持。